WebCanning Procedure Wash jars. Prepare lids according to manufacturer’s instruc-tions. Fruits in jars may be covered with your choice of water, apple, or white grape juice, or, more commonly, a very light, light, or medium syrup. Prep jars for canning and keep … WebAug 25, 2016 · Simply taste the syrup and decide if you want it sweeter or not. Select ripe but firm peaches otherwise they’ll get very mushy once canned. The best way to peel peaches is to briefly blanch them in boiling water for about 45 seconds – the peels will slip off easily.
